Position Overview
We are seeking a skilled QA Automation Engineer to join our Enterprise Digital Solutions team in Hyderabad, India . In this role, you will design, build, and maintain reliable automated tests across UI and API layers, embed quality checks into CI/CD, and partner with Engineering and Product to prevent defects early. You'll contribute to scalable test architecture using Playwright with TypeScript/JavaScript and help improve test stability, coverage, and release confidence.
Key Responsibilities
Test Automation Development
- Develop and maintain automated test suites for critical user journeys (smoke, regression, end-to-end).
- Create maintainable UI automation using Playwright and TypeScript/JavaScript (reusable fixtures, selectors, and page abstractions).
- Build and enhance API automation (request validation, data setup/teardown, and basic contract checks where applicable).
- Analyze failures, triage defects, and collaborate with engineers to identify root causes and prevent regressions .
Framework & CI/CD Integration
- Contribute to and continuously improve the Playwright automation framework (structure, utilities, reporting, and test patterns).
- Implement scalable execution capabilities such as parallelization, environment orchestration, and reliable test data management.
- Integrate automation into CI/CD pipelines (PR validation and nightly runs), with clear reporting and quality gates to support fast, reliable releases.
- Leverage AI/LLM tooling (where approved) to accelerate test case authoring, refactoring, and failure triage (log/trace summarization).
- Follow responsible AI and data-handling guidelines; collaborate with Security/Platform teams to ensure compliant use of AI-enabled testing.
